Uklon Expands Urban Mobility Ecosystem with $2.2M E-wings Acquisition

  • Uklon, a Kyivstar subsidiary, will acquire E-wings for UAH 97.6 million ($2.2 million).
  • The deal is expected to close in Q3 2026, subject to customary closing conditions.
  • E-wings operates 3,000 electric scooters across 11 Ukrainian cities.
  • Uklon plans to integrate E-wings' services into its existing ride-hailing and delivery platform.
  • Kyivstar aims to create a comprehensive urban mobility ecosystem.

Kyivstar's acquisition of E-wings aligns with the broader trend of telecom companies diversifying into digital services. The deal underscores the strategic importance of urban mobility as a driver of user engagement and revenue growth. With this acquisition, Kyivstar is positioning itself as a key player in Ukraine's evolving mobility landscape, competing with both local and international tech firms.
